England's Anya Shrubsole, a two-time Women's World Cup and inaugural T20 World Cup winner, on Thursday, announced her retirement from international cricket, ending a 14-year career at the highest level.
The 30-year-old finished with 173 international games for England, picking 227 wickets and was also a part of two Ashes-winning and two World Cup-winning campaigns.
Shrubsole bagged nine wickets at 29.66 at the ICC Women's Cricket World Cup 2022, during England's run to the final. Her best performance in the tournament came in the final against Australia, in which she registered figures of 3/46 in England's 71-run defeat.
